Bonuses, Promotions, and Wagering Terms
Welcome bonuses and ongoing promotions can add value, but their headline figures should never be viewed in isolation. A bonus may require a minimum deposit, a specific code, eligible games, a time limit, or a wagering requirement before winnings can be withdrawn. Some games may contribute less towards wagering than others, while certain promotional funds can have maximum win restrictions.
Always read the full terms before accepting an offer. Pay particular attention to the minimum qualifying deposit, maximum bet allowed during wagering, expiry date, withdrawal rules, game contribution percentages, and any restrictions on combining promotions. If the conditions are difficult to understand, contacting support before opting in is a sensible step.
How to Compare a Promotion
- Calculate the total amount that must be wagered, not just the advertised bonus.
- Check whether the offer applies to slots, table games, or live casino titles.
- Confirm the minimum and maximum deposit requirements.
- Review the deadline for completing the promotion.
- Find out whether bonus funds or winnings are subject to a maximum withdrawal.
Payments and Account Protection
Reliable payment processing is essential for a positive casino experience. Common options may include cards, bank transfers, digital wallets, and selected alternative payment services. Availability depends on the operator and the player’s location. Deposit times are often immediate, whereas withdrawals may require additional processing and identity checks.
Verification procedures are standard across regulated gaming websites. Operators may request proof of identity, address, or payment ownership to prevent fraud and comply with financial regulations. Players can protect themselves by using a unique password, enabling two-factor authentication where available, avoiding public Wi-Fi for account access, and checking transaction notifications regularly.
Responsible Gaming Matters
Casino games should be treated as entertainment rather than a dependable source of income. Set a budget before playing, use only money that can be spent comfortably, and decide on a time limit. Never chase losses, borrow money to gamble, or increase stakes simply because a previous session went badly. Random games do not become more likely to win after a losing result.
Many established operators provide practical tools such as deposit limits, session reminders, cooling-off periods, and self-exclusion. These features can help players maintain control. If gaming begins to affect finances, relationships, work, or emotional wellbeing, stop playing and seek support from a recognised gambling assistance organisation in your region.
